Enhancing vendor relationships is critical for achieving better business outcomes, optimizing supply chain efficiency, and fostering collaboration. Here’s a detailed guide on how to enhance vendor relationships effectively:
1. Establish Clear Communication Channels
Effective communication forms the basis of strong vendor relationships:
– Regular Meetings: Schedule regular meetings to discuss ongoing projects, challenges, and opportunities.
– Open Communication: Encourage vendors to share concerns and ideas openly.
– Clarify Expectations: Ensure both parties understand roles, responsibilities, and deliverables clearly.
2. Foster Trust and Transparency
Building trust is essential for long-term vendor relationships:
– Honesty and Integrity: Be transparent about business practices, challenges, and goals.
– Reliability: Consistently meet commitments and deadlines to build trust.
– Fairness: Ensure fair and equitable treatment in all interactions and transactions.
3. Define Mutual Goals and Objectives
Aligning on goals enhances collaboration and performance:
– Shared Vision: Establish common objectives that align with both parties’ strategic goals.
– Performance Metrics: Define clear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) to measure success.
– Continuous Improvement: Collaborate on strategies to achieve mutual growth and improvement.
4. Collaborative Problem-Solving
Address challenges proactively and collaboratively:
– Root Cause Analysis: Identify and address underlying issues causing disruptions or inefficiencies.
– Solution-Oriented Approach: Work together to find practical solutions and implement improvements.
– Feedback Mechanism: Establish a feedback loop for continuous improvement and adjustment.
5. Performance Monitoring and Evaluation
Monitor vendor performance to ensure quality and efficiency:
– Performance Reviews: Conduct regular evaluations based on predefined metrics and benchmarks.
– Feedback Sessions: Provide constructive feedback and recognize outstanding performance.
– Quality Assurance: Ensure adherence to agreed-upon standards and specifications.
6. Incentivize and Reward Excellence
Acknowledge and incentivize vendors for exceptional performance:
– Performance-Based Contracts: Include performance incentives tied to achieving KPIs and milestones.
– Recognition Programs: Publicly acknowledge vendors for their contributions and achievements.
– Long-Term Partnerships: Offer opportunities for extended partnerships and collaboration.
7. Embrace Technology and Innovation
Utilize technology to streamline processes and drive innovation:
– Digital Integration: Implement collaborative platforms for seamless communication and data sharing.
– Innovation Initiatives: Explore joint innovation projects and opportunities for process optimization.
– Adapt to Industry Trends: Stay updated on industry trends and technological advancements to remain competitive.
